The analysis has showed that in the initial period after treatment, the pesticide entering the plant tissue is very intense and the decomposition rate are slow Gradually the plants mobilize their vital resources and in the next 10 days break down more than half of the pesticides in the plant tissue. It is likely that during this period the plants require optimal conditions for development a sufficient amount of moisture, mineral nutrition, etc. The quantitative picture of the analysis, 10 days after the treatment of with Oberon, there is no signs on the plant surface and therefore its entry into the plant tissue ceases, but the drug have decomposed by this time about by half , i.e. 19 mg per 1 kg of the green mass. The amount of the agent drops the safe level after 2 weeks. Such calculations allow you to set the time for treating crops before harvesting and to develop other preventive measures for the safe use of pesticides.
